As part of the investigation into the death of former Minister of Transport Arif Ahmet Denizolgun, his doctor Nurettin Demirkol was arrested.
The statement of doctor Nurettin Demirkol, who was arrested within the scope of the investigation into the death of former Minister of Transport Arif Ahmet Denizolgun, was revealed at the Criminal Court of Peace.
In his first statement as a witness on August 26, 2026, Demirkol said that he did not know who called the medical and law enforcement teams, that Denizolgun was not a private doctor, and that he did not consider the death suspicious. However, in the 155 Emergency Call resolution report prepared by the Riva Police Station, it was determined that the report was made over the phone used by Demirkol, the caller introduced himself as the family doctor and said that the death was suspicious.
Asked about this contradiction, Demirkol said, "I don't remember whether I called or someone else called on the day of the incident. Someone else may have called from my phone." The prosecutor's office also asked Demirkol why he did not remember whether he made the first report, even though he remembered meeting the police several times on the day of the incident. Demirkol said that he had difficulty even remembering the patients he had recently cared for and said, "Approximately 10 years have passed since the incident." Demirkol also said that he "left his phone lying around" at the scene, and that one of the people coming and going to the farm might have made a report on his phone.
IT WAS DETECTED THAT HE INTRODUCED AS 'FAMILY DOCTOR'
On the other hand, it was determined that there was a contradiction in Demirkol's statements regarding the doctor-patient relationship with Denizolgun. It was determined that Demirkol had previously said 'I was not his private doctor' and in the statements of the police and crime scene investigators who went to the scene, there were records indicating that there was a person who introduced himself as a 'family doctor' at the scene.
When asked about this situation, Demirkol said, "I examined the victim 2-3 times. However, I do not know how to become a family doctor. I do not know what is meant by this expression."
The prosecutor's office determined that the location information in Demirkol's first statement did not match the HTS records. In his statement on August 26, Demirkol said that he was at his residence in Kısıklı on the day of the incident. However, during the prosecutor's interrogation, he was told that there was no base record in the Kısıklı region between 6 September 2016 at 18.12 and 8 September 2016 at 17.46. When asked about this issue, Demirkol said, "It is not possible for me not to have a base record for two days. I was at my residence that day. I do not know why the base records appeared this way."
"I DON'T REMEMBER MY INTERVIEWS"
The prosecutor's office also stated that Demirkol said that Denizolgun had already died when he went to the scene, but HTS records showed that he made consecutive calls to the phone registered to Hisar Hospital between 21.16 and 21.42 on September 7, 2016. Asked about the reason for the meetings, Demirkol said, "I do not remember the meetings I had that day."
"I DON'T REMEMBER IF I TALKED OR NOT"
In Demirkol's first statement, he said that Murat Bayrak and a foreign national were present when he went to the farm; However, it was revealed that the crime scene investigation report in the investigation file included a record that Hilmi Tuna Kuriş was also at the scene, and in the HTS investigation, it was determined that Kuriş had left the area where the farm was located at 20.56 on September 7, 2016.
The prosecutor's office also determined that there were records of consecutive calls and calls between Demirkol and Hilmi Tuna Kuriş on the same night at 21.13 and onwards. Asked about these records, Demirkol said, "I don't remember whether I talked to Hilmi Tuna Kuriş that day. I don't know if he was there when I went."
When Demirkol was asked whether Ahmet Yum, Ahmet Gökçen and Alihan Kuriş came to the scene, another witness in the file stated that the forensic doctor who came to the scene said that there was a lawyer with the doctor and that Alihan Kuriş was at the scene.
When asked whether there was a phone call recorded between Demirkol and Ahmet Yum on the morning of September 8, 2016, Demirkol said that he did not remember whether these people came to the scene and why he met with Ahmet Yum.
